Competence Assurance

The objective of this project is to develop a Competence Assurance System for Forensic Science Laboratory Practitioners.

Accountability
The CAP group will report to the ENFSI Quality and Competence Committee, QCC. It will develop generic proposals for a competence assurance system and support the Expert Working Groups in applying these in their specific areas.

Communication
As far as possible, all working documents will be distributed by e-mail/fax between the members of the CAP group and there will be specified time scales for responses. Project team members will make their best efforts to meet these time scales.

The CAP group will meet twice a year to review progress, to discuss any issues arising and to identify the work to be completed by the next meeting. The minutes of these meetings will be distributed to the QCC.

All ENFSI laboratories will be consulted before any proposals/recommendations are submitted to the QCC for endorsement.

The CAP group shall maintain contact with organisations outside of ENFSI that are working to similar objectives.

Funding
The CAP group has obtained funding from the EU for the project. Remaining costs for participating in meetings of the CAP group will be met by the laboratories of the members.

Progress

A: To develop a Code of Practice/Conduct for ENFSI Forensic Science Practitioners:

  • Review the Codes of Practice/Conduct currently available. start: 12/00 end: 05/01
  • Develop a draft Code of Practice/Conduct for ENFSI Forensic Science Practitioners.
    start: 04/01 end: 08/01
  • Revise draft and submit to QCC. start: 08/01 end: 09/01
  • Discuss draft at QCLG meeting on 03/02.
  • Discuss draft at Annual Meeting on 05/02.
  • Communicate with ENFSI laboratories and Working Groups. start: 05/02 end: 10/02
  • Revise draft. start: 10/02 end: 11/02
  • Submit proposal for decision to QCC and ENFSI board on 11/02.

B: To develop competence standards for Practitioners in the Forensic Process

  • Develop Standards of Competence for main Practitioners in the Forensic Process.
    start: 12/00 end: 05/02
  • Consultations about the standards with WG's and laboratories. start: 05/02 end: 10/02
  • Identify and define all relevant groups of Practioners. start: 05/02 end: 10/02
  • Submit SoC for main Practitioners to QCC on 11/02.

C: To develop a Process for the Assessment of Competency

  • Develop a generic approach for the assessment of competency. start: 05/02 end: 10/02
  • Develop specific methods of assessment of the competencies in B. start: 05/02 end: 03/03

D: To develop Training and Education Materials

  • Produce a list of forensic science training courses and training materials available in Europe.
  • Develop questions to support assessment of the Core Competencies
  • Support the Expert Working Groups in developing questions and other means for assessing the evidence type specific and specialist competencies.

E: To develop a process for European Certification of Forensic Practitioners

  • Review the standards and processes currently available for certification.
  • Develop a process of certification based on assessment methods in C.
